Traditionally in the past, different departments within your organization may use disparate methods to record risks assessment values or audit results, as well compliance data. It can be difficult to determine how your business reduces risks while adhering to policies and regulations. GRC software facilitates the coordination of data collection across teams and departments in a single platform. This gives you an overview of the governance processes.
Corporate governance requires your business to make public any information that could be important or relevant to directors, shareholders, auditors, employees, suppliers, customers, and suppliers. This information could include financial reports and changes to operations and the results of board meetings, new hires and departures, and other events that could affect the long-term well-being and sustainability of your business.
A lot of the rules that govern contemporary corporate governance are based on the idea of shareholder primacy. This theory states that managers are motivated to maximize shareholder value, even if it can have negative effects on their company and employees.
